Windows系统ADB驱动安装与配置完全指南
如何解决Windows环境下安卓设备连接难题?
在Windows系统中使用安卓设备进行调试、文件传输或固件更新时,设备无法识别的问题屡见不鲜。这一现象通常源于驱动程序缺失、版本不兼容或系统权限配置不当。本文将系统介绍如何通过专业工具实现ADB驱动的自动化部署,解决各类设备连接问题,同时提供企业级应用方案与深度技术解析。
ADB驱动自动化部署工具的核心价值
ADB(Android Debug Bridge)驱动作为连接Windows系统与安卓设备的关键组件,其正确配置直接影响开发效率与设备兼容性。专业ADB驱动安装工具通过以下技术特性实现差异化优势:
- 动态版本管理:实时检测并部署最新版ADB与Fastboot组件,自动清理旧版本残留文件
- 驱动签名解决方案:内置无签名驱动安装程序,绕过Windows 10/11的驱动签名验证机制
- 环境变量智能配置:自动将ADB工具路径添加至系统环境变量,支持全局命令调用
- 多版本Windows适配:针对Win7/10/11系统特性优化安装流程,解决系统差异导致的兼容性问题
 ADB驱动安装工具命令行界面展示,清晰呈现驱动部署全过程
设备连接诊断与驱动安装任务指南
基础连接任务:首次设备识别配置
前置条件:
- 安卓设备开启开发者选项与USB调试模式
- Windows系统具备管理员操作权限
- 设备通过USB线缆连接至电脑,选择"文件传输"模式
执行流程:
- 从项目仓库克隆工具包:
git clone https://gitcode.com/gh_mirrors/la/Latest-adb-fastboot-installer-for-windows - 导航至项目目录,双击运行
Latest-ADB-Installer.bat - 当系统提示用户账户控制请求时,点击"是"授予管理员权限
- 等待工具自动完成组件下载、驱动安装与环境配置
验证方法: 打开命令提示符,输入以下命令验证安装结果:
adb devices
若返回设备序列号与"device"状态,表明驱动安装成功。
高级任务:多设备并行管理配置
前置条件:
- 已完成基础驱动安装
- 多台安卓设备通过USB集线器连接至电脑
- 所有设备均已开启USB调试并信任当前计算机
执行流程:
- 运行桌面快捷方式
Latest ADB Launcher.bat - 在工具菜单中选择"设备管理"选项
- 系统将自动枚举所有连接设备并显示详细信息
- 可通过设备序列号指定目标设备执行ADB命令
验证方法: 使用设备选择命令验证多设备识别状态:
adb devices -l
命令输出应包含所有连接设备的型号、序列号与连接状态。
故障排除决策树
设备未检测到问题
症状:adb devices命令返回空列表
- 检查USB调试是否已启用 → 是 → 更换USB端口测试
- 检查USB调试是否已启用 → 否 → 在设备开发者选项中启用
- 更换线缆测试 → 问题解决 → 原线缆故障
- 更换线缆测试 → 问题依旧 → 重新安装驱动
驱动签名错误
症状:设备管理器显示黄色感叹号
- Windows 7系统 → 禁用驱动签名强制 → 重新安装
- Windows 10/11系统 → 启用测试模式 → 安装工具签名驱动
- 测试模式启用失败 → 使用工具内置的签名绕过工具
环境变量配置问题
症状:命令提示符显示"adb不是内部或外部命令"
- 手动检查系统环境变量PATH → 包含ADB路径 → 重启命令提示符
- 手动检查系统环境变量PATH → 不包含ADB路径 → 重新运行安装程序修复
技术原理解析:驱动签名与ADB协议基础
Windows驱动签名机制
Windows操作系统通过驱动签名机制确保系统安全性,未签名或签名无效的驱动程序将被阻止加载。ADB驱动安装工具采用两种技术方案解决此限制:
- 测试签名模式:在Windows 10/11系统中启用测试模式,允许安装测试签名驱动
- 签名绕过工具:通过微软官方测试工具链生成临时签名,实现无签名驱动的合规加载
ADB通信协议架构
ADB协议采用客户端-服务器-守护进程(CSD)架构:
- 客户端:运行在Windows系统的ADB命令行工具
- 服务器:在Windows后台运行的ADB服务进程
- 守护进程:安装在安卓设备上的adbd后台服务 三者通过USB或TCP/IP网络建立通信,实现命令转发与数据传输。
企业级部署指南
网络分发方案
企业环境中可通过以下方式实现工具的集中部署:
- 将安装包托管至内部文件服务器
- 创建组策略对象(GPO),配置计算机启动脚本自动执行安装
- 通过MDM(移动设备管理)系统推送安装任务
批量设备管理策略
针对企业级多设备管理场景,建议配置:
- ADB无线调试模式,摆脱USB连接限制
- 建立设备管理数据库,记录设备序列号与权限配置
- 部署ADB命令脚本自动化测试与部署流程
配套工具链推荐
ADB命令行增强工具
提供图形化ADB命令界面,支持一键截屏、文件管理与应用安装等常用操作,适合非技术人员快速上手。
安卓设备信息查看器
可深度读取设备硬件信息、系统版本与已安装应用列表,辅助诊断设备兼容性问题。
ADB无线连接管理器
实现ADB连接的无线化管理,支持多设备同时连接与命令批量执行,提升多设备调试效率。
驱动版本管理工具
自动跟踪ADB驱动更新,提供版本回滚与差异比较功能,确保企业环境驱动版本一致性。
设备连接日志分析器
记录设备连接全过程日志,通过智能分析识别潜在问题,生成详细诊断报告。
通过以上工具组合,可构建完整的安卓设备管理生态,满足从个人开发到企业级部署的全场景需求。ADB驱动安装工具作为基础组件,其自动化部署能力大幅降低了安卓开发环境配置门槛,为高效设备管理提供技术保障。
GLM-5智谱 AI 正式发布 GLM-5,旨在应对复杂系统工程和长时域智能体任务。Jinja00
GLM-5-w4a8GLM-5-w4a8基于混合专家架构,专为复杂系统工程与长周期智能体任务设计。支持单/多节点部署,适配Atlas 800T A3,采用w4a8量化技术,结合vLLM推理优化,高效平衡性能与精度,助力智能应用开发Jinja00
jiuwenclawJiuwenClaw 是一款基于openJiuwen开发的智能AI Agent,它能够将大语言模型的强大能力,通过你日常使用的各类通讯应用,直接延伸至你的指尖。Python0192- QQwen3.5-397B-A17BQwen3.5 实现了重大飞跃,整合了多模态学习、架构效率、强化学习规模以及全球可访问性等方面的突破性进展,旨在为开发者和企业赋予前所未有的能力与效率。Jinja00
AtomGit城市坐标计划AtomGit 城市坐标计划开启!让开源有坐标,让城市有星火。致力于与城市合伙人共同构建并长期运营一个健康、活跃的本地开发者生态。01
awesome-zig一个关于 Zig 优秀库及资源的协作列表。Makefile00